PHP與MySQL是當前最流行的Web開發語言和關系型數據庫,它們的結合使用可以實現強大的Web應用程序。其中,PHP與MySQL的映射原理和實現方法是Web開發中的重要知識點之一。
一、PHP與MySQL的映射原理
PHP與MySQL的映射原理是指將PHP程序中的數據類型和MySQL數據庫中的數據類型進行對應,并在程序中實現它們之間的轉換。PHP與MySQL的映射原理主要包括以下幾個方面:
1. 數據類型的映射
PHP與MySQL中的數據類型是不完全相同的,需要進行對應映射。例如,PHP中的字符串類型對應MySQL中的VARCHAR類型,PHP中的整型對應MySQL中的INT類型等。
2. 數據庫連接的映射
ysqlinect()或PDO等函數進行連接,而MySQL中使用用戶名、密碼、主機名等參數進行連接。
3. SQL語句的映射
ysqli_query()或PDO等函數執行SQL語句,而MySQL中使用SELECT、INSERT、UPDATE、DELETE等關鍵字來執行相應的操作。
二、PHP與MySQL的實現方法
PHP與MySQL的實現方法主要包括以下幾個方面:
1. 數據庫連接方法
ysqlinectysqlinect()函數連接MySQL數據庫的語法為:
kysqlinectameame', 'password', 'database');
ameame'是MySQL用戶名,'password'是MySQL密碼,'database'是要連接的MySQL數據庫名。
PDO連接MySQL數據庫的語法為:
ysqlameame=database";ame";
$pass = "password";ew, $user, $pass);
是數據庫源名稱,包括主機名、數據庫名等信息;$user是用戶名,$pass是密碼。
2. 數據類型轉換方法
tgt等。
3. SQL語句執行方法
ysqliysqli_query()函數執行SQL語句的語法為:
ysqlik, $sql);
k是連接MySQL數據庫的返回值,$sql是要執行的SQL語句。執行成功后,$result將包含查詢結果。
PDO執行SQL語句的語法為:
t = $dbh->prepare($sql);t->execute();
tentt將包含查詢結果。
PHP與MySQL的映射原理和實現方法是Web開發中的重要知識點,掌握它們可以幫助開發人員更好地進行Web應用程序開發。在實際開發中,需要根據具體情況選擇合適的方法進行數據操作,同時要注意安全性和性能等方面的問題。